PMAnti-AGEs® Silibinin is a next-generation natural anti-aging active ingredient series developed by Plamed Green Science Group.

Derived from natural Milk Thistle (Silybum marianum) seeds, the product is obtained through advanced extraction and purification technologies to deliver a high concentration of Silibinin (Silibinin A+B).

As the most biologically active constituent of silymarin, Silibinin accounts for approximately 50–70% of the overall activity and demonstrates outstanding performance in antioxidant protection, anti-glycation, collagen preservation, and skin rejuvenation.

Unlike conventional anti-aging strategies that rely primarily on antioxidant activity, PMAnti-AGEs® Silibinin focuses on:

Maintaining ECM (Extracellular Matrix) Homeostasis

By stimulating collagen regeneration, strengthening the elastic fiber network, inhibiting AGE formation, and reducing MMP activity, PMAnti-AGEs® Silibinin helps improve visible signs of aging at the structural level of the skin.

Botanical Information

Item Description
Common Name Milk Thistle
Botanical Name Silybum marianum (L.) Gaertn.
Family Asteraceae
Plant Part Used Mature Seeds
Native Region Europe and the Mediterranean Region
Active Compound Class Flavonolignan Complex
Key Active Constituent Silibinin

Active Composition

Component Typical Content
Silibinin 50–70%
Silychristin ~20%
Silydianin ~10%
Isosilybin ~5%

Studies have demonstrated that Silibinin is the most important bioactive component within the silymarin complex. It exhibits stronger antioxidant, anti-inflammatory, TNF-α inhibitory, and ROS-scavenging activities than other related flavonolignans.

2. MMP Inhibition

Matrix metalloproteinases (MMPs) are major enzymes responsible for collagen degradation.

Research has shown that Silibinin significantly suppresses MMP-1 expression, thereby:

  • Reducing collagen breakdown
  • Preserving dermal matrix integrity
  • Slowing wrinkle development

3. Anti-Glycation Activity

Advanced Glycation End Products (AGEs) contribute to:

  • Collagen fiber stiffening
  • Elastin fragmentation
  • ECM disorganization

These changes accelerate visible skin aging.

Silibinin has been shown to:

  • Inhibit CML formation
  • Reduce protein carbonylation
  • Decrease AGE accumulation

As a result, it helps maintain a healthy and functional ECM network.


4. Antioxidant Protection

Ultraviolet radiation and environmental pollution induce excessive production of reactive oxygen species (ROS).

Elevated ROS levels can cause:

  • Collagen degradation
  • DNA damage
  • Inflammatory responses

Studies indicate that Silibinin significantly reduces intracellular ROS levels, helping protect the skin against oxidative stress-induced damage.

Product Recommended Use Level
PMAnti-AGEs® Silibinin 80 0.02% – 0.20%
PMAnti-AGEs® Silibinin 98 0.01% – 0.10%

Formulation Recommendations

  • Add during the cooling phase
  • Processing temperature below 45°C
  • Recommended pH range: 4.5–7.0

Q:What are the respective content ratios of Silybin A and Silybin B in PMAnti-AGEs® Silibinin? Is it strictly controlled?

A: Currently, our quality control and Certificate of Analysis (COA) monitor the combined total content of Silybin A + B, without strict restrictions on the individual ratios of A and B (as commercial reference standards in the industry are mostly mixed standards). Once individual standard samples for A and B are procured, we will test multiple batches to monitor stability and consider incorporating finer internal control standards based on client feedback.

Q:Will the ratio between Silybin A and B fluctuate across seasons? Does it significantly impact skincare efficacy?

A: Tracking data demonstrates that the ratio between Silybin A and B fluctuates negligibly with seasonal changes and remains stable overall, thereby posing no adverse impact on the final skincare efficacy.

Q:How is the solubility of the two specifications of PMAnti-AGEs® Silibinin? What solvents can be referenced?

A: Both specifications of PMAnti-AGEs® Silibinin are water-insoluble. Based on our reference tests with a high-purity (98%) benchmark on the market, it can achieve a clear 1% solubility in propanediol and butanediol, which formulators can use as a processing reference during sample preparation.

Q:At the in vitro efficacy tests (at 0.05% and 0.2%), how was the raw material dissolved into the test system?

A: For cell-based assays, we first completely dissolved PMAnti-AGEs® Silibinin using Dimethyl Sulfoxide (DMSO) to prepare a highly concentrated stock solution, which was subsequently diluted with the cell culture medium to the final test concentrations of 0.05% and 0.2%.

Q:Is PMAnti-AGEs® Silibinin heat-resistant? Can it withstand conventional emulsification production at around 80°C?

A: According to authoritative literature data, silymarin fundamentally maintains excellent physicochemical stability under temperatures below 80°C. Plamed is currently arranging further laboratory testing to monitor high-temperature discoloration and content stability.

Q:Why do trace black small particles (impurities) or precipitates sometimes appear when PMAnti-AGEs® Silibinin80 is dissolved in polyols?

A: This is a normal processing occurrence. These trace black particles are primarily caused by slight uneven heating and mild carbonization during the industrial spray-drying process. It is a physical phenomenon that is difficult to completely avoid in natural high-purity plant extraction processes and typically does not affect the core efficacy.

Q:Is there a risk of precipitation if Silymarin is directly incorporated into an emulsion after dissolution or dispersion? How should it be processed?

A: Given that silymarin has extremely low solubility in water, a certain risk of precipitation does exist. In actual formulation production, many insoluble materials exist stably in a “dispersed state.” It is recommended to thoroughly disperse Silymarin in polyols (e.g., pentanediol, recommended ratio 1:10) until uniform, and then introduce it into the pre-emulsified emulsion batch under thorough stirring. Tests show that at typical dosages of 0.2% to 0.5%, the cream formula remains highly uniform with no visible precipitation.

Q:Will adding Silymarin into a cream system cause severe odor or formulation stability issues?

A: Regarding Odor: Lower-purity silymarin does carry a characteristic botanical odor, whereas the higher-purity specification (e.g., 98%) has an extremely faint smell. Since Silymarin is highly effective at low dosages, its addition level is typically low, making the odor easy to mask with fragrances or base ingredients.

Regarding Stability: When dispersed in cream or lotion configured with polymers or thickeners, its dispersed phase remains highly stable and will not trigger visible separation or stability issues.
